网站简介

browserRedirect()是一个用于检测用户设备类型以及执行相应重定向操作的JavaScript函数。

该函数通过解析用户的userAgent来获取设备类型信息,包括是否为 iPad、iPhone OS、MIDP、UC7、UC浏览器或Android设备。根据不同的设备类型,browserRedirect()函数会执行相应的重定向动作。

以下是该函数的主要代码:

function browserRedirect() {  
var sUserAgent = navigator.userAgent.toLowerCase();  
var bIsIpad = sUserAgent.match(/ipad/i) == "ipad";  
var bIsIphoneOs = sUserAgent.match(/iphone os/i) == "iphone os";  
var bIsMidp = sUserAgent.match(/midp/i) == "midp";  
var bIsUc7 = sUserAgent.match(/rv:1.2.3.4/i) == "rv:1.2.3.4";  
var bIsUc = sUserAgent.match(/ucweb/i) == "ucweb";  
var bIsAndroid = sUserAgent.match(/android/i) == "android";  
var bIsCE = sUserAgent.match(/windows ce/i) == "windows ce";  
var bIsWM = sUserAgent.match(/windows mobile/i) == "windows mobile";  
  
// 根据设备类型执行相应的重定向操作  
}  

使用browserRedirect()函数,可以根据不同设备类型执行相应的重定向操作,以提供针对不同设备的优化用户体验。